It's completely finished!

We wound up holding off on the D3/K2 supplement, planning on making possibly a D3 cream and a K2/Magnesium Orotate supplement in its stead. As of this writing, it'll have 5mg of MK4, 45mcg of MK7, and not sure how much Mag. Orotate yet in each capsule (3 capsules a day, 30-day supply).

Pricing is pretty much wrapped up, everything's real competitive, and the bottles look mint. Immortal is working on the educational material, and once that's wrapped up in a few days, it'll be online and available! Here is what we have so far:

Antarctic Krill Oil

Antioxidant Boost (combination of Curcumin/Resveratral/Sulforaphane)

Pure Ecklonia Cava

Stabilized R-Lipoic Acid

No ALCAR yet, that'll be sometime down the road, only because it's pretty cheap and widely available. We have some other cool ideas as well, but all depends on the support the line gets. If we can raise the funds, we can come out with some neat stuff. Next post will be the official release post!
